Is Dolly Parton Really Hitting the Road for a New Tour?

Well, this is where things get a bit interesting, and perhaps not what some folks might have been hoping for. On a Thursday, which was May 23rd, Dolly Parton, it seems, let out some details about what sounded like a possible new set of shows. However, there's a pretty important detail to keep in mind: she herself won't be there in person, performing on stage for these particular plans. So, when people ask, "When will Dolly Parton tour again?" and think of her physically on stage, this news might feel a little different, basically.

The country music icon, you know, made an announcement about a fresh program called "Threads: My Songs in Symphony." This sounds like a rather special kind of event, bringing her music to life in a new way. It's set to come to Nashville, Tennessee, on March 20, 2025. This particular program is a way for her songs to be heard and enjoyed, but it's not a traditional tour with her singing live at each stop. It's a bit of a clever approach, allowing her work to continue to reach fans, even if she's not there herself, which is pretty smart, in a way.

The "Here You Come Again" Musical - A Different Kind of Tour

Beyond traditional concerts, there's another exciting way Dolly Parton's music is reaching people, and it's through a musical comedy called "Here You Come Again." This is a show that's absolutely packed with her well-known songs, and it's a different sort of experience altogether. It's not Dolly Parton herself on stage, but rather a story brought to life through her beloved tunes. This particular production is coming to Sydney, Australia, in September 2025, with tickets available straight from the Theatre Royal Sydney. So, when people ask, "When will Dolly Parton tour again?" this musical is a significant part of the answer, offering a fresh way to enjoy her work, basically.

This musical has already made its debut in the UK, starting in Leeds from Saturday, May 11th, to Saturday, June 8th. After that initial run, "Here You Come Again" is set to go on a rather large tour across the UK. It brings together, for the very first time, all of Dolly Parton's biggest hits in a lively and happy new musical. What's more, it's fully authorized by Dolly herself, which means she has given her blessing to this creative way of presenting her songs. It's a wonderful opportunity for fans to experience her music in a story-driven format, which is quite unique, you know?

Why the Queen of Country Might Not Be Touring in Person

This is a rather important point when we consider the question of "When will Dolly Parton tour again?" Dolly Parton herself has, in fact, indicated that she has quietly stepped away from the idea of touring extensively. She played only a small number of shows in 2022 and hasn't confirmed anything for 2023 in terms of a full tour. She's been quite open about her feelings on the matter, saying, "I do not think I will ever tour." This is a pretty clear statement from her, you know, about her future plans for hitting the road for long periods.

The country music legend, now at 76, thinks her days of touring are probably behind her. She's made it clear that while she doesn't plan to do full tours anymore, she might still do special shows here and there. For example, she told Pollstar in 2022, "I do not think I will ever tour again, but I do know I'll do special shows here and there." This suggests a shift in how she plans to share her music live. Her career has been going strong for nearly six decades, and she's won a lot of awards and gathered many fans, but it seems she's ready to slow down the pace of constant travel, basically.

She's expressed this sentiment on more than one occasion, making it quite consistent. It appears that while her passion for music and connecting with people remains strong, the demands of a full touring schedule are something she's choosing to step away from. This means that when you ask, "When will Dolly Parton tour again?" the answer for big, long tours is likely "not anymore," but for special, one-off appearances, there's still a chance. It's a decision that, you know, reflects her stage in life and her desire to spend more time at home, as she has made a rare mention of her husband, Carl Thomas Dean, and why she won't be touring anymore.
